Decide the order before you open the app

Three tiers, in this sequence: first the things you would be annoyed to run out of, then one product aimed at the concern you actually have, then whatever is left of the budget on something new.

Tier one is cleanser, toner, sunscreen — the stuff you use daily. Stocking those at a discount produces the most visible result because you stop rationing them. Tier two is a single serum or cream. One. Buying three actives at once means you cannot tell which one did anything. Tier three is where curiosity goes, ideally in a mini or a set so it doesn’t become inventory.

  • Check the dates. Korean products typically run three years unopened and six to twelve months after opening. Anything you cannot finish in a year is not actually cheaper.
  • Check whether coupons stack. The Mega Sale coupon, shop coupons and cart discounts don’t always combine, and the final number only appears at checkout.
  • Buy from one shop where you can. Shipping consolidates and everything lands the same day.

1. numbuzin — No. 3 Super Glowing Essence Toner

Tone-up serum

The one that turned “my skin looks less tired” into a category. It has a slight slip to it, and the surface of your face reads smoother almost immediately — light comes back evenly instead of in patches. A single press under foundation noticeably changes how the base sits.

This is not a product that rebuilds your skin. It changes how your skin reads, which is a different and more achievable job, and it does it without anything aggressive in the formula.

Buy it if: your face goes flat and grey by late afternoon, or you want glow without tack.

2. Anua — Heartleaf 77% Soothing Toner

Toner

Houttuynia cordata — heartleaf — as the headline ingredient, and the reference point for the whole soothing-toner category. It is thin as water, so it works either swiped on a cotton pad or pressed in with your hands. Keep it for the night after a sunburn, or the week the weather turns and your face starts reacting to everything.

It comes in a large size and there is a refill, which is exactly what you want from something you will reach for daily.

Buy it if: you flush easily, or your skin stings during seasonal changes.

3. Torriden — DIVE-IN Low Molecular Hyaluronic Acid Serum

Hydrating serum

Several molecular weights of hyaluronic acid in a formula whose defining quality is how little it leaves behind. You can layer it in July without the surface going slick, which is the whole problem it solves: hydration for people who do not want more oil on their face.

Effectively unscented and fine under makeup, so it survives the morning routine rather than getting skipped.

Buy it if: you are dehydrated but oily, or creams feel heavy to you.

4. medicube — Zero Pore Pad

Exfoliating pad

Textured on one side, smooth on the other. The job is lifting the mix of dead skin and oil that makes pores feel gritty. Twice or three times a week, on the areas that actually need it — not nightly, and not across your whole face.

Follow it with moisture every single time. Skip that and you get the dryness-then-more-oil loop, which leaves pores looking worse than when you started.

Buy it if: your nose and cheeks feel rough, or foundation sinks into your pores by noon.

5. TIRTIR — Mask Fit Red Cushion

Cushion foundation

Thin on the skin but genuinely covering, which is a harder combination than it sounds. The shade range is unusually granular for a Korean cushion, so there is a real chance of finding yours rather than settling. Finish lands semi-matte, and it breaks down tidily instead of going patchy.

Sets with a refill turn up during the sale, which is worth it once you have committed to a shade.

Buy it if: you want coverage without weight, or you care how your base looks at hour eight.

6. VT COSMETICS — Reedle Shot

Booster

Built around micro-scale stimulation at the surface, the idea being that whatever you apply next gets in more effectively. The strengths are numbered, and starting at the lower one is not a suggestion. A brief tingle on application is normal, which is reason enough to begin on one area rather than the whole face.

This is an active. Don’t stack it with retinol or acids on the same night.

Buy it if: your routine has stopped producing change, or you want to work on texture.

7. Beauty of Joseon — Relief Sun

Sunscreen

None of the chalky white cast or heaviness that makes people quietly use less sunscreen than they should. It contains rice bran extract and spreads like a light lotion, so it slots onto the end of a morning routine instead of fighting it.

Sunscreen only works in the amount you are willing to apply. This is the category where buying several during a sale changes your behaviour, and behaviour is the whole game.

Buy it if: sunscreen texture puts you off, or you want one you will reuse indoors daily.

8. rom&nd — Glasting Water Tint

Lip tint

Watery weight and shine at once, without the tack a thick gloss leaves behind — the colour stays put and the stickiness doesn’t. The shade range is deep enough that people buy several in a sale and rotate them seasonally, which is the sensible way to use it.

In dry months, put a balm underneath first. It stops the colour from settling unevenly.

Buy it if: you want shine without stick, or a flush of colour that reads like your own.

9. COSRX — Advanced Snail 96 Mucin Power Essence

Essence

Heavily concentrated snail secretion filtrate, and for a lot of people the first Korean skincare product they ever finished. It is properly viscous — warm it between your palms and press it in rather than trying to spread it, and it absorbs without a film. Most people reach for it to bring skin back rather than to push it forward.

If slip bothers you, start with less. The texture is comfortable enough to take down onto your neck.

Buy it if: your skin is easily upset, or you want one product as an entry point.

10. mixsoon — Bean Essence

Minimal essence

Fermented soybean, and a deliberately short ingredient list. Its real use is as a reset: when nothing you add is calming your skin down, this strips the routine back without leaving you with nothing. Viscous but not occlusive, and it doesn’t block whatever comes after.

The short formula is also diagnostic — it makes it far easier to work out what your skin has been reacting to.

Buy it if: your routine has grown too many steps, or you want to simplify and observe.

The short version

A sale is for consolidating what you already use, not for discovering eleven things at once. Lock in the daily consumables, add one product aimed at one concern, and your routine holds steady until the next Mega Sale.
